When the pH of the nutrient solution is too low or too high, certain elements (e.g., iron or manganese) could be wholly or partially “locked out.” The sweet spot, pH 5.8–6.3, is the ideal pH range for high-value plants grown in hydroponic gardens. To ensure that their plants can take up the optimal amount of nutrients, growers need to keep the pH of the nutrient solution balanced. If the pH is just a little too high or a little too low, it can leave plants suffering from nutrient deficiencies.

ABOUT pH.

In 1909, S. P. L. Sørensen was the head of the Carlsberg Beer research lab in Denmark. He discovered that the concentration of hydrogen ions in proteins correlated to acidity or alkalinity.

For example, when too high of a concentration was present, the beer clouded and unwanted flavors were pulled from the wort, making good beer even better.

Sørensen devised a scale that was closest to the pH scale we use today. His scale measured the “potential hydrogen” in a liquid.

The pH scale goes from 0—most acidic—to 14—most alkaline or basic. If a liquid measures 7, then it’s neutral.

THE pH SCALE

The pH scale is logarithmic, which means that each value on the scale is actually 10 times lower or higher than the value next to it.

Liquids with a pH of less than 7 are acidic. (lemon juice, vinegar etc.)

Liquids with a pH of more than 7 are alkaline. (hand soap, baking soda)

pH RANGE AND NUTRIENT UPTAKE.

At Emerald Harvest, we talk a lot about the “sweet spot”. The best range for hydroponically grown cannabis plants is pH 5.8 to 6.3, although you’ll often see that expressed as 5.5 to 6.5 to give a wider margin for measurement. This range is a kind of compromise among the various optimal pH ranges of all the essential plant nutrients, ensuring that plants absorb at least the minimum.

A big challenge for growers is that each essential nutrient enters plants best within a certain pH range:

  • Nitrogen has a fairly large range
  • Iron is best taken up when the pH is slightly acidic.
  • Molybdenum is best when pH is slightly alkaline
